I missed some of the second set but saw the tiebreak

Very close. Hannah was 3-5 down.

Overall, I think the second set was pretty 50:50

Hannah probably edged it fractionally - her top shots were better than Brooke's top shots

But Brooke really needs to address why she started so poorly today, and yesterday

Hannah's backhand is miles better than it was this time last year - it is a pleasure not to be stressed every time she has a backhand to hit, seeing most half way up the net

It makes her so much better balanced, and kills the obvious strategy that all opponents went for last year
